Low‐Pressure Nitrocarburizing in Standard Vacuum Furnaces—Preliminary Studies
Low‐pressure nitrocarburizing is performed in a standard vacuum furnace, using ammonia/acetylene atmosphere. Performed studies confirm the safety of the process—no toxic gases and undesired deposit are generated during the process. Nitrocarburizing of 16MnCr5 alloy steel samples results in the increase in hardness and formation of 20 μm effective case ...

Spectroscopic study of plasma nitrocarburizing processes with an industrial-scale carbon active screen [PDF]
The active screen plasma nitrocarburizing technology is an improvement of conventional plasma nitrocarburizing by providing a homogeneous temperature distribution within the workload and reducing soot formation.
